Call of Duty: World at War is a first-person shooter developed by Treyarch and published by Activision. The game returns the series to its World War II roots, featuring campaigns set in the Pacific and Eastern European theaters of the war. Players experience intense combat missions focusing on the brutal realities of warfare during this period.
The PlayStation 3 version includes a single-player campaign that follows U.S. Marines and Soviet soldiers through various historic battles. Gameplay emphasizes infantry combat, vehicle sections, and use of period-appropriate weaponry. The game also features the popular cooperative Nazi Zombies mode, where players survive waves of undead enemies.
Multiplayer on the PS3 supports up to 18 players, offering a variety of competitive game types with weapon customization and perks. The version includes trophy support and online matchmaking compatible with other platforms.
Call of Duty: World at War received positive reviews for its gritty atmosphere, engaging gameplay, and the introduction of the Zombies mode. According to Metacritic, the PlayStation 3 version holds favorable review scores, solidifying its place as a key entry in the Call of Duty franchise.
